Joseph R — Morris practices personal injury law in Plymouth, Indiana. He has been a prominent figure in the legal community since his admission to the Indiana State Bar in 1996. The firm he leads has a strong focus on personal injury cases, alongside a robust practice in criminal law, including DUI and DWI defense. His office is well-known for handling a diverse range of cases throughout Indiana. He earned his J.D. from Valparaiso University School of Law in 1996, where he developed a focus on advocating for clients who have suffered injuries due to the negligence of others.

Prior to that, he completed his B.S. in Psychology at Ball State University in 1991. This educational background gave him a unique understanding of the human experience, which he applies to his legal practice. Most of his work involves representing clients in personal injury claims, including automobile accidents, slip and fall incidents, and workplace injuries. Cases typically progress from initial consultations to negotiations with insurance companies, and, when necessary, litigation in court.
